About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Partner with Sales to ensure all deals are well-structured and aligned with commercial policies.
- Manage and process US Channel Purchase Orders (POs).
- Execute Channel Stocking Orders for inventory availability.
- Serve as a central support hub for the sales-side booking and fulfillment within Salesforce.
- Identify and report system bugs or process inefficiencies.
- Provide critical support during high-volume periods during EOQ and EOY cycles.
- Demonstrate high levels of self-sufficiency and resourcefulness by interpreting complex documentation.
Requirements
What you’ll need- Proven experience applying or implementing Deal Desk best practices.
- At least 1 year of professional experience in tech or enterprise software sales support, sales operations, or a related enablement capacity.
- Flexibility to support global operations across various time zones.
- Hands-on proficiency with Salesforce (SFDC) and a strong understanding of maintaining data integrity across integrated business systems.
